logo

Output 3f602898c721c13a8bdee46d95c0abc5943c239a73b4c163fc5565d7c7c29431:2

value
59862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baff11460adddaa9adf56a3a958c0061f270ac86 OP_EQUAL
address
3JjmAd6G9TXW9EnKzSkCzTAvw1ibZYLmzP
transaction
3f602898c721c13a8bdee46d95c0abc5943c239a73b4c163fc5565d7c7c29431